Advantages of email marketing

Cost-effective
email marketing can be relatively cost-effective compared to many other forms of marketing. We don't charge for advertising or print, or media space.

Permission-based
This means that only persons who have actively decided to receive email communications from you will be on your marketing list. This is because customers genuinely interested in your products and services are more inclined to engage with your business.

Flexibility in the design
choose whether to send plain text, graphics, or attachments. Design options provide you the freedom to express your business's identity.

It increases the number of visitors to your website.
Email marketing messages can assist you in driving visitors to your website. For example, you can include links to your website or product pages in your emails. Furthermore, you can create appealing content that will persuade your clients to purchase on your website. There are numerous tactics you can employ to attract an increasing number of potential consumers.

It is manageable and easily trackable.
As technology advances, automated tools software allows you to measure your campaigns and marketing plans. For example, email marketing solutions will enable you to monitor overall effectiveness by displaying the number of people who got your email, read your email, or purchased things via email.

It helps to build the reputation of your brand.
Not only can email marketing help you increase brand recognition among new clients, but it can also help you attract new businesses. Furthermore, you can expand your reach so that new people become acquainted with you whenever an existing client shares a message or an offer with his friends or family.

You may learn what works for you and what does not.
Using email marketing and analytics solutions, you can obtain metrics to see how your email marketing efforts perform. The valuable insights allow you to work smarter.

Furthermore, it provides you with critical data that you need to determine customer interest and demand.

Marketers can determine which services or goods customers are interested in based on click-through rates.

Time-saving
With the use of automation, you can send emails to clients in response to an action they've taken on your website. Once you've created a template, you can use it for various email campaigns in the future.
Ex: you can send a welcome email when a person registers for your website or a discount incentive if they abandon their shopping cart.

Disadvantages of Email Marketing

Here are some of the disadvantages of email marketing. Pay special attention to these to develop a strategic email marketing campaign.

Spam
Readers can become irritated when they receive an excessive number of promotional and spam email messages. In addition, people may unsubscribe from you if you do not target the right audience. As a result, you must ensure that your marketing activities comply with privacy guidelines and target people interested in receiving your emails.

Problems with Design
Your email and its content must be appropriately formatted so that recipients may view it on any device.

Size Concerns
If your email contains large-sized photographs, it may not open. This may irritate the audience, and you may lose them.
